网站安全保障措施范文
在数字化时代,互联网已成为人们日常生活和工作的重要组成部分,随着网络安全威胁的日益复杂与多变,确保网站的安全性显得尤为重要,本文将详细介绍一些有效的网站安全保障措施,帮助您构建一个安全、稳定且用户友好的在线平台。
网站安全保障是保护您的业务免受恶意攻击、数据泄露和欺诈行为的关键,通过实施以下措施,可以有效提高网站安全性,并增强用户的信任度。
身份验证与授权管理
网站登录安全
-
双因素认证(2FA):为每位用户提供一种额外的身份验证方式,如短信验证码或指纹识别,以防止未经授权的访问。
// 使用JavaScript实现简单2FA示例 function verifyOTP(otp) { if (otp === 'yourSecretCode') { return true; } else { return false; } }
-
使用OAuth协议:OAuth是一种开放标准,用于创建授权框架,允许第三方应用程序获取用户资源访问权限,而无需存储或共享用户的敏感信息。
-
定期更新密码策略:要求用户设置强密码,并提醒他们更换过期的密码。
数据加密与传输安全
-
HTTPS连接:所有交互均需通过HTTPS进行,以保证数据传输过程中的机密性和完整性。
<head> <title>Secure Site</title> <script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/https-compress.min.js"></script> <style> body { margin: 0; padding: 0; background-color: #f0f0f0; font-family: Arial, sans-serif; } </style> </head> <body> <!-- Your website content here --> </body>
-
SSL证书:安装SSL证书,确保网站上的所有通信都是加密的。
反向代理与防火墙
-
负载均衡器:使用Nginx或HAProxy等工具来分发流量到多个服务器上,减轻单点故障风险。
-
入侵防御系统(IPS):部署IPS设备来检测并阻止潜在的网络攻击,例如DDoS攻击。
漏洞扫描与持续监控
-
定期进行安全审计:利用自动化工具对网站进行全面扫描,查找可能存在的安全漏洞。
-
配置日志记录:详细记录所有的操作活动,以便于后续分析和追溯。
-
事件响应计划:制定应急预案,一旦发生安全事故,能迅速采取行动恢复服务。
用户教育与反馈机制
-
用户教育:定期组织网络安全培训,提升用户的安全意识。
-
建立反馈渠道:提供匿名举报功能,鼓励用户报告可疑活动或安全问题。
构建和维护一个安全可靠的网站需要持续的努力和投入,通过上述措施的实施,不仅可以保护您的网站免受外部威胁,还能增强用户体验,促进长期发展,网络安全是保护个人隐私和商业利益的关键,投资于先进的技术解决方案和最佳实践是非常必要的。